A team inbox starts with a properly connected channel.

A social profile link and a messaging integration do different jobs. The first helps a customer reach you; the second allows supported messages to reach a connected workspace. NEXIS provides an inbox workflow, but each external channel needs its own permissions and setup.

How the workflow works

  1. Choose the channel you actually need

    Identify where customers contact you and distinguish a public contact button from a connected inbox. Test one channel first so you can understand its permissions, message behaviour and operational requirements.

  2. Authorise the appropriate account

    Use the channel setup in your workspace with an authorised business account. Instagram messaging requires an eligible professional account and the necessary permissions and approval. A public Instagram link does not complete this process.

  3. Send a new test conversation

    From a separate test customer account, send a new message and check whether it reaches the workspace. Test the supported manual reply flow. Do not judge historical import from a new-message test: they are different capabilities.

  4. Connect the conversation to a next step

    Agree who responds and how the team records follow-up. If the customer needs an appointment, share the booking route. A message alone does not mean a confirmed appointment or a completed payment.

Check before you launch

  • For Instagram, verify a new direct message and a manual text reply with your account permissions.
  • Historical Instagram conversations, comment replies and autonomous AI replies are not promised by this workflow.
  • Threads inbox is not available. Do not treat a public Threads link as a messaging integration.
  • WhatsApp messaging and automated reminders have separate account, consent, template and subscription requirements.

Questions about this workflow

Will adding a WhatsApp link connect the inbox?

No. A public contact link opens a contact route for visitors. The platform messaging connection requires separate authorisation and configuration.

Can I reply to Instagram comments or import all old conversations?

These capabilities are not included in the published new-message and manual text-reply scope. Test supported direct messages with your authorised professional account.

Does AI automatically answer every customer?

No. Do not assume autonomous replies from the presence of an AI feature. Review the configured workflow and keep human responsibility for customer responses.
